This podcast provides guidance for high school students navigating the college admissions process, emphasizing personal development alongside academic strategies. It features insights from experts and coaching sessions aimed at helping students identify their passions, develop effective application strategies, and maintain mental wellness throughout the admissions journey. Notably, it integrates discussions on mental health, creating a supportive environment for both students and parents, which may set it apart in the realm of college admissions resources.
